Enable Task Manager Disabled by Viruses

If you have any experience about viruses, then probably you may notice most of the viruses are affect to the task manager and disable it completely right after affect to the computer.This is because if we know that there is a virus active in our background there’ll be a chance to stop it using task manager. Disable task manager doing by viruses editing the computer registry.Here how you can fix and get back the Task manager again.

Method 1:Click Start >> Run >> and type the code below and press Enter.
REG add HKCU\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Pol icies\System /v DisableTaskMgr /t REG

Method 02:Click Start>> Run>> and type Regedit.exe (open registry editor)
Navigate to the HKEY_CURRENT_USER \ Software \ Microsoft \ Windows \ CurrentVersion \ Policies\ System .In the right-pane, delete the value named DisableTaskMgrClose Registry editor. You may want to restart you computer for changes take effect.

Method 3:Click Start >> Run >> type gpedit.msc (Open Group policy editor)
Navigate to:User Configuration / Administrative Templates / System / Ctrl+Alt+Delete Options / Remove Task Manager .Double click the Remove Task Manager option.Change the policy to Not Configured and click ok.
